When he saw this news about missing people, He was on his way to his hometown in Hunan. During the more than 20 days of fake disappearance, He cut off all previous contact with the outside world, so he couldn’t see the circle of friends that his wife had just sent. Until now, he still felt that his wife was just hiding somewhere to get angry with himself.
Although he had a similar experience before, this time He was not so sure. In order to disguise his disappearance more realistically, 22 days ago, he rented a car from the leasing company and drove it from a cliff in Zijiang to the river in the dark.
After driving the rented car to Zijiang, He Mou fled to Guizhou in the car he bought two years ago. In 2016, in order to buy this car and rent it, He borrowed a sum of money through online loans for the first time. According to He’s memory, he borrowed 40,000 yuan or 50,000 yuan online for the first time, and at first he thought he could turn it around. But slowly he found that this is a bottomless pit that is difficult to fill.
Suspect He Mou: "You may not find the interest when you first started to borrow, that is, you can still turn around at first, but after you roll for one year, don’t say the principal, maybe you can’t repay the interest."
In order to repay the loan of one family, He borrowed from another family, thus robbing Peter to pay Paul, with higher and higher loans and more and more debts. Until September this year, He decided to take risks. According to the police, On September 7th, He bought a personal accident insurance with a coverage of 1 million yuan in China Ping An Insurance for 1699 yuan, and the beneficiaries were He and Dai.

[What’s the hidden story behind the absurd scam]
In order to cheat insurance and avoid debts, He Mou wrote and directed such a scam, and behind this seemingly absurd plan, there are many problems encountered by He Mou’s family. After He arrived at the case, according to the police investigation, his arrears and interest totaled 400,000 to 500,000 yuan. By the time he arrived at the case, there were still 170,000 to 80,000 debts outstanding.
Xiao Zhiping, instructor of the Criminal Investigation Brigade of Xinhua County Public Security Bureau, Hunan Province: "He has no specific figures of his own. He only talked about more than 100,000 yuan, how many times he borrowed, and how many loans he found from this company. He can’t remember clearly."
In October 2017, his wife, Xiao Dai, received a land acquisition fee from her hometown, totaling more than 200,000 yuan. However, the money was turned over to He Mou to fill in the pit of online loans.
The two also got a divorce certificate because of the debt problem, and remarried after half a year. However, the extremely vulnerable families, who are already suffering from debt, have also suffered a more fatal blow. In June 2017, their little daughter was diagnosed with severe epilepsy. According to He, her daughter spent a total of more than 100,000 yuan on medical treatment, and took part of the expenses through online crowdfunding and medical expenses reimbursement, which reduced the burden of seeing a doctor a lot, but it still could not offset those online loans before He.
Even so, the couple never mentioned the difficulties they encountered with their families, and the news about their daughter’s illness and crowdfunding also blocked their families. Every time I go back to my hometown, I look like love and happiness. Therefore, the family does not know that this seemingly happy family has already been swallowed up by various problems such as online loans and daughter’s illness.

Unfortunately, the appearance of happiness did not last long. Due to the inability to repay the loan, the loan platform called the debt collection phone to He’s parents’ home. It is only a drop in the bucket for He’s parents to help him borrow money several times. The heavy debt, plus the illness that his daughter will have at any time and the cost of follow-up treatment, He decided to take risks and fake his death to cheat insurance.

[The bad news came that mother and son passed away]
He Mou, who was guilty and hopeful, stayed at home until dawn the next day. On October 11th, the police continued to search for Xiao Dai’s missing pond. At ten o’clock in the morning, the police found three mothers and children in the pond, but unfortunately all three had passed away.
When the bad news came, He Mou regretted it. Just coming back so late led to a life tragedy in which his wife and children passed away. Perhaps it was not only the time to return, but he had already planted the seeds of this tragedy from the beginning when he had the idea of committing crimes.
On October 12, He Mou surrendered himself to the public security organ. At present, he is criminally detained on suspicion of vandalism and insurance fraud. The case is under further investigation.

Experts pointed out that even if there is no tragedy of his wife and children drowning, this insurance fraud plan planned by He will not be easily realized, but will only make him fall into a deeper whirlpool.
Zhu Wei, deputy director of Communication Law Research Center of China University of Political Science and Law, said: "He used a very extreme means and an illegal act to defraud insurance money. Even if this matter, if according to his idea, his wife and children will have no problem, but can you really get insurance money in the end? No, because he didn’t find the last body, the body with quotation marks, and he had to go through a related process of declaring missing or even dying. This process will also take several years and require complicated legal procedures. Have you ever thought, even if it is really successful, what if this person appears again, won’t this incident happen when it comes to the public? Don’t just for this one million, hiding from the urgent need, and the children’s wives will never meet again? Then have you thought about what to do with your family in the future? "
